best flat roof waterproofing

The best flat roof waterproofing represents a cutting-edge solution designed to protect commercial and residential buildings from water damage and environmental elements. This advanced waterproofing system combines innovative materials and installation techniques to create an impermeable barrier that effectively shields the roof structure. Modern flat roof waterproofing typically involves multiple layers of high-performance membranes, including EPDM rubber, TPO, or PVC materials, which are specifically engineered to withstand UV radiation, extreme temperatures, and heavy rainfall. The system incorporates sophisticated drainage solutions and strategic application methods that ensure complete coverage and long-lasting protection. These waterproofing solutions are particularly effective in preventing common issues such as water pooling, membrane deterioration, and structural damage. The technology behind these systems has evolved to include self-healing properties and enhanced flexibility, allowing the waterproofing to maintain its integrity even under challenging weather conditions. Installation procedures are precisely controlled to ensure optimal adhesion and seamless coverage, while the materials used are selected for their durability and resistance to environmental stress.

The best flat roof waterproofing systems offer numerous compelling advantages that make them an essential investment for property owners. First and foremost, these systems provide superior protection against water infiltration, effectively preventing costly water damage to the building's interior structure. The advanced materials used in modern waterproofing solutions offer exceptional durability, with many systems lasting 20 to 30 years with proper maintenance. This longevity translates into significant cost savings over time, as it reduces the frequency of repairs and replacements. These systems also demonstrate remarkable energy efficiency properties, reflecting sunlight and reducing heat absorption, which can lead to lower cooling costs during summer months. The installation process, while thorough, is less disruptive than traditional roofing methods, allowing businesses to maintain operations with minimal interruption. Modern waterproofing solutions are also environmentally conscious, often incorporating recyclable materials and reducing the carbon footprint of buildings through improved insulation properties. The flexibility of these systems allows them to accommodate building movement and thermal expansion without compromising their protective capabilities. Additionally, they provide excellent resistance to chemical exposure, UV radiation, and extreme weather conditions, ensuring consistent performance throughout their lifespan. The systems also feature advanced moisture detection capabilities, making it easier to identify and address potential issues before they develop into serious problems.

Advanced Material Technology

Advanced Material Technology

The cornerstone of superior flat roof waterproofing lies in its advanced material technology. Modern systems utilize high-performance synthetic membranes that are specifically engineered to provide maximum protection against water infiltration while maintaining exceptional durability. These materials feature multiple layers of reinforced polymers that work together to create an impenetrable barrier against moisture. The molecular structure of these materials is designed to maintain flexibility even in extreme temperature conditions, preventing cracking and splitting that commonly occur with traditional waterproofing methods. The materials also incorporate UV-resistant compounds that prevent degradation from sun exposure, ensuring the waterproofing system maintains its protective properties for extended periods. This technological advancement in material science has resulted in waterproofing solutions that can withstand severe weather conditions while providing consistent performance throughout their service life.
Seamless Installation System

Seamless Installation System

The installation process of premium flat roof waterproofing employs a sophisticated seamless application system that ensures complete coverage without weak points or vulnerable areas. This system utilizes advanced application techniques that create a continuous, monolithic surface across the entire roof area. The process begins with thorough surface preparation, followed by the application of specialized primers that enhance adhesion. The main waterproofing membrane is then applied using state-of-the-art equipment that ensures consistent thickness and proper bonding. Special attention is paid to critical areas such as corners, joints, and penetrations, where reinforcement materials are integrated to provide additional protection. The seamless nature of the installation eliminates the risk of water infiltration through joints or seams, which are common failure points in traditional roofing systems.
